# Lintmarrow baseline configuration
# Plugin authors: the baseline file (.lintmarrow-baseline.json) freezes
# existing findings so your plugin only reports new issues. Never edit
# the baseline by hand; regenerate with `lintmarrow baseline --update`.
# Findings suppressed by the baseline still appear in verbose output.
# Baseline uploads to the shared cache require authentication.
# The cache credential is set on the next line.

secret setting of hawep-yahig: LEDGER_TOKEN29=41b5d6315371c92885eaeb077fb63

As part of our quarterly security routine, we rotated the release signing key for AlertFold, the on-call alert deduplicator. The old key was revoked immediately after the new builds were published, so any artifact signed before this release will now fail verification — this is expected, not a regression. New team members: always verify downloaded builds before deploying to the Harsten or Mirelle environments, and never skip the check with the override flag. Verification should be performed against the current key, shown below.

deploy key for bawig-tajop: bky9_PQ3GVoQw1

// VENDORED_FONT_MANIFEST pins the exact set of third-party typefaces
// bundled with the Quillmark editor. We vendor fonts rather than fetch
// them at build time so releases are reproducible and license audits
// stay simple — each entry records the face name, version, and license
// file path. Release managers: do not update this manifest without
// refreshing the license bundle in the same change. The manifest hash
// must match the value stamped into the release artifact shown below.

build token for bahip-fawif: htk3_6a1

### Step 4: Dark mode for the Admin dash

Welcome aboard! The Fernwick admin dashboard supports dark mode via a theme bundle that gets compiled at deploy time, not runtime — so yes, you need to rebuild to see theme changes. Run the theme build before the main asset step, or you'll ship a half-styled dashboard and someone will post a screenshot in chat. The theme compiler pulls design tokens from our internal token service, which requires a key in your deploy env file. Drop in this line:

vault entry, hawip-bahif: COURIER_KEY20=0cc4378a8ab04bccc3fd